The Kern & Sohn Mobile Leeb Hardness Meter HMM is a portable and highly precise device for non-destructive hardness testing on metallic materials. With a measuring range of 170 to 960 HL, it delivers accurate and fast readings, making it ideal for quality control, inspection, and industrial applications. Its compact design and user-friendly interface allow for easy operation in the field or lab environments.
The Kern & Sohn HMM Hardness Meter is an essential tool for professionals in mechanical engineering, metallurgy, and material science looking for fast and dependable hardness testing.
